Team Nolan and Team Byrd’s matchup for Week 1 was simmed and concluded with Team Nolan taking the win. Tom Brady, Todd Gurley II, Antonio Brown, and Rob Gronkowski combined for 92.6 points out of 178.2 points. However, Team Byrd came back in Week 2 delivering a 155.9-117.5 blowout against Team Nolan. Team Byrd´s key players included; Michael Thomas, Zach Ertz, and Tyreek Hill which combined for 71.3 points. Now both teams sit at 1-1, wondering who will take Week 3 and sit in a lead.

Team Nolan had a rough Week 2 with Rob Gronkowski only producing 3.5 points, Greg Zuerlein not kicking a single field goal which also doesn´t get a single point, and the defending champs losing 27-21 gave them 3 points. Week 3 is when Team Nolan needs its players to step up and produce points.

Team Byrd, although he did pick up a Week 2 win, needs some minor tweaking. Alvin Kamara put up 17.6 but did struggle for most of the game against the Cleveland Browns. Julio Jones was limited to 11.2 points. For Team Jason to earn a Week 3 win and move to 2-1, he needs to keep an eye on the running backs to see which will perform the best on Sunday. He also might need to bench Jones this week, as he has a difficult matchup against the New Orleans Saints and is questionable. With his status as questionable, he may underperform as he did last week. A.J. will take his place and will hopefully create and produce.
